Dietitian note

Citrus fruits like oranges, lemons, grapefruits, and limes are acidic. This high acidity level can irritate the lining of the esophagus, which is already inflamed in individuals with GERD. This irritation can lead to heartburn, acid reflux, and other uncomfortable symptoms. Whole fruits and juices are likely to lead to discomfort.
